Walking Threads (WT) is an ongoing project involving scholars and practitioners Paola Esposito, Ragnhild Freng Dale, Valeria Lembo, Peter Loovers and Brian Schultis – and a yarn of golden thread. We first met in March 2014 at Performance Reflexivity, Intentionality and Collaboration: a Sourcing Within work-session.
